Fix the 'queue' script tool to work with copy-type PackageUploads
Bug #791204 reported by
Gavin Panella
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Launchpad itself |
Fix Released
|
High
|
Jeroen T. Vermeulen |
Bug Description
This probably involves (or depends on) changing DistroSeries.
Related branches
lp:~jtv/launchpad/bug-791204
- Graham Binns (community): Approve (code)
-
Diff: 595 lines (+348/-48)8 files modifiedlib/lp/soyuz/browser/queue.py (+1/-1)
lib/lp/soyuz/browser/tests/test_queue.py (+46/-0)
lib/lp/soyuz/configure.zcml (+4/-0)
lib/lp/soyuz/interfaces/queue.py (+13/-1)
lib/lp/soyuz/model/queue.py (+53/-35)
lib/lp/soyuz/scripts/queue.py (+12/-6)
lib/lp/soyuz/scripts/tests/test_queue.py (+99/-5)
lib/lp/soyuz/tests/test_packageupload.py (+120/-0)
lp:~jtv/launchpad/pre-bug-791204-getPackageUploads-name-filter
- Julian Edwards (community): Approve
-
Diff: 718 lines (+458/-26)7 files modifiedlib/lp/registry/interfaces/distroseries.py (+4/-2)
lib/lp/registry/model/distroseries.py (+6/-4)
lib/lp/soyuz/interfaces/queue.py (+6/-1)
lib/lp/soyuz/model/queue.py (+91/-19)
lib/lp/soyuz/tests/test_packageupload.py (+203/-0)
lib/lp/testing/factory.py (+62/-0)
lib/lp/testing/tests/test_factory.py (+86/-0)
lp:~jtv/launchpad/more-pre-791204-lint
- Stuart Bishop (community): Approve
-
Diff: 425 lines (+45/-80)7 files modifiedlib/lp/soyuz/browser/queue.py (+15/-23)
lib/lp/soyuz/browser/tests/test_queue.py (+5/-12)
lib/lp/soyuz/interfaces/queue.py (+3/-9)
lib/lp/soyuz/model/queue.py (+1/-2)
lib/lp/soyuz/scripts/queue.py (+5/-5)
lib/lp/soyuz/scripts/tests/test_queue.py (+11/-24)
lib/lp/soyuz/tests/test_packageupload.py (+5/-5)
Changed in launchpad: | |
assignee: | Gavin Panella (allenap) → Jeroen T. Vermeulen (jtv) |
tags: |
added: qa-ok removed: qa-needstesting |
tags: |
added: qa-ok removed: qa-needstesting |
Changed in launchpad: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
Fixed in stable r13213 (http:// bazaar. launchpad. net/~launchpad- pqm/launchpad/ stable/ revision/ 13213) by a commit, but not testable.